Asia Pacific Market Overview
The Asia Pacific CNC Machines Market originated alongside the broader development of industrial machinery in the region, initially driven by conventional mechanical tools and manual machining processes. With industrialization waves sweeping through countries such as Japan in the mid-20th century, followed by rapid manufacturing growth in China, South Korea, and emerging economies like India and Southeast Asia, the CNC market began its transformative journey. Early CNC machines in the region mainly focused on basic automation, replacing manual control with computer-driven commands to enhance precision and repeatability. Over time, technological advancements accelerated, with the integration of sophisticated computer technology, software controls, and digital connectivity marking key turning points. The evolution of CNC technologies in the Asia Pacific has been closely tied to rising demand for high-efficiency manufacturing, supported by government initiatives to boost mechanization and industrial output. As industries across automotive, aerospace, electronics, and metalworking sectors increasingly adopted CNC solutions, the market transitioned from simple numerical control devices to multi-axis, high-speed, and intelligent machines. This progression laid the foundation for the current state, characterized by the confluence of automation, smart manufacturing, and digital integration, positioning the Asia Pacific CNC machines market as a critical enabler of global manufacturing competitiveness and precision engineering.
Among the prevailing trends shaping the Asia Pacific CNC machines market, three stand out for their transformational impact. First, the shift toward smart factory adoption has been propelled by the need for enhanced operational efficiency and real-time manufacturing intelligence. This trend integrates CNC machines with IoT, data analytics, and AI-driven monitoring, enabling predictive maintenance and optimized production workflows, which has contributed to greater manufacturing agility across the region. Second, the emergence of miniaturization and desktop CNC technology addresses the growing demand for compact, cost-effective, and high-precision machining solutions, especially for small and medium enterprises and startups. This trend lowers entry barriers and enables customization, fostering a broader application base across industries such as electronics and biomedical devices. Third, increasing emphasis on additive manufacturing alongside traditional subtractive CNC machining reflects an industry shift toward hybrid production capabilities. This convergence allows manufacturers to combine precision machining with 3D printing, expanding design freedom and reducing material waste, thereby enhancing sustainability and innovation potential within the market. Collectively, these trends are driving a dynamic transformation, encouraging manufacturers to embrace versatile, intelligent, and economically viable CNC technologies.
Key players in the Asia Pacific CNC machines market have adopted multi-faceted strategies to maintain leadership and capture growing opportunities. Innovation remains central, with firms heavily investing in the development of autonomous CNC systems and machine vision integration to enhance precision and reduce human intervention. Partnerships with technology providers, software developers, and manufacturing end-users facilitate collaborative advancements that improve interoperability and ease of use. Expansion strategies include localization of production facilities and service networks within major manufacturing hubs such as China, Japan, and India, enabling quicker response times and customization for regional clientele. Additionally, companies are focusing on building ecosystems around smart manufacturing technologies by integrating CNC machines with broader Industry 4.0 solutions. Investments in training programs and after-sales services further reinforce customer engagement and loyalty. This comprehensive approach balances technological development with market responsiveness and operational scalability, securing competitive advantage amid intensifying industry demands.
The competitive landscape of the Asia Pacific CNC machines market is characterized by a nuanced balance between differentiation through innovation and strategic pricing. Regional players often leverage local manufacturing capabilities, cost advantages, and in-depth understanding of domestic market requirements to challenge global incumbents. Conversely, global manufacturers draw on advanced R&D, brand reputation, and extensive service networks to retain premium segments. Innovation-driven differentiation manifests in features such as enhanced multi-axis machining, real-time process monitoring, and smart automation integration, enabling companies to command higher value propositions. At the same time, pricing competitiveness remains crucial within highly price-sensitive emerging markets, prompting firms to offer scalable solutions tailored to specific industrial needs. The interplay between regional adaptability and global technological standards fosters a dynamic competitive environment where continual product enhancement and strategic geographic presence dictate market positioning and growth.
On the basis of Machine Type, the Computer Numerical Control (CNC) Machines Market in Asia Pacific is classified into CNC Lathes, Machining Centers, CNC Milling Machines, CNC Grinding Machines, Laser & Plasma Cutting Machines, Electrical Discharge Machines, and Other Machine Type in 2025.
The CNC Lathes segment acquired the largest revenue share in the Computer Numerical Control (CNC) Machines Market in Asia Pacific. The dominance of this segment is driven by the region’s strong manufacturing base, particularly in countries such as China, Japan, South Korea, and India, where mass production and precision machining are critical. The high demand for automotive components, industrial equipment, and consumer goods is significantly supporting the widespread adoption of CNC lathes across the region.
The Machining Centers segment recorded a significant revenue share in the Computer Numerical Control (CNC) Machines Market in Asia Pacific. The growth of this segment is supported by increasing adoption of automation and multi-functional machining solutions that improve productivity and reduce operational time. Rapid industrialization and the expansion of manufacturing facilities are further driving demand for machining centers.
The CNC Milling Machines segment witnessed a notable revenue share in the Computer Numerical Control (CNC) Machines Market in Asia Pacific. These machines are widely used for complex and high-precision component manufacturing, particularly in electronics, automotive, and general manufacturing industries, supporting their strong demand.
The CNC Grinding Machines segment attained a significant revenue share in the Computer Numerical Control (CNC) Machines Market in Asia Pacific. The growth of this segment is driven by the need for precision finishing and high-quality surface treatment, especially in sectors such as automotive and aerospace manufacturing.
The Laser & Plasma Cutting Machines segment recorded a notable revenue share in the Computer Numerical Control (CNC) Machines Market in Asia Pacific. The increasing demand for high-speed, efficient, and accurate cutting technologies in metal fabrication and heavy industries is supporting the growth of this segment.
The Electrical Discharge Machines segment witnessed a notable revenue share in the Computer Numerical Control (CNC) Machines Market in Asia Pacific. These machines are essential for machining hard materials and complex geometries, particularly in tool and die manufacturing, electronics, and precision engineering applications.
The Other Machine Type segment also holds a steady presence in the Computer Numerical Control (CNC) Machines Market in Asia Pacific. This segment includes specialized CNC equipment that supports niche applications and emerging manufacturing technologies as the region continues to advance in industrial innovation.
